HIBB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review
171 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hibbett, Inc. Common Stock (HIBB)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$347M — down 29% from $488M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 30 funds opened new HIBB posit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 62 added to existing stakes and 52 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, adding an estimated $13.9M. The largest seller was Champlain Investment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$13.7M sold.
